A Graduate Certificate in Mindful Wellness Practices equips students with the knowledge and skills to integrate mindfulness techniques into various wellness settings. The program emphasizes practical application, preparing graduates for immediate impact in their chosen fields.
Learning outcomes for this certificate include a comprehensive understanding of mindfulness theory and practice, proficiency in teaching mindfulness-based interventions (MBI), and the ability to design and deliver tailored wellness programs. Students will also develop strong self-care practices and cultivate a deep understanding of ethical considerations within the wellness profession.
The duration of the Graduate Certificate in Mindful Wellness Practices typically ranges from 12 to 18 months, depending on the specific program and the student's pace of study. Many programs offer flexible online learning options, accommodating the needs of working professionals.
This certificate holds significant industry relevance, catering to a growing demand for mindfulness-based approaches in healthcare, education, corporate wellness, and private practice. Graduates are well-positioned for careers as mindfulness instructors, wellness coaches, yoga instructors, and meditation teachers. The program’s focus on evidence-based practices and professional development enhances career prospects significantly within the expanding field of holistic wellness.
Specific skills learned include stress reduction techniques, emotional regulation strategies, and mindfulness-based cognitive therapy (MBCT) components, leading to professional competence in holistic wellness practices. The integration of these skills facilitates career advancement across multiple sectors requiring mental health and wellness expertise.
